## Runbook: Canary Gating Rules

For the weekly sync: Driftgate canaries promote automatically only when error rate stays under 0.5% and p95 latency within 10% of baseline for 30 minutes. Any manual override must be logged in the gating table with a reason. Rollbacks reset the observation window. Gate decisions and override history are stored in the deploy-metrics database; query it using the connection string below.

primary connection of hadup-kajeg = clickhouse://rusath_svc:lTa6pgZ@db-a477.plorvaforge.corp:5432/oliox

Subject: On-call prep — Quillhatch timetable solver

Welcome to the rotation. Quick notes for the eng sync: solver timeouts page you directly; constraint conflicts go to the queue. Never restart mid-solve — schools lose draft timetables. Escalate anything touching exam-week runs. The triage flowchart and paging matrix are on the internal page listed below.

wiki page, yafop-fadup: https://jira.qorvelsys.internal/projects/display/projects/pages

Subject: Reconciliation job access — welcome aboard

Hi there,

Welcome to the Brindlewick integration! The nightly inventory reconciliation job pulls stock counts from our Stockmark API and diffs them against your warehouse feed. Runs at 02:00 and posts a summary to the shared channel. If counts drift by more than 2%, it flags a mismatch report for manual review.

To run the job manually against staging, authenticate with the token below.

session JWT of yawep-yawep = eyJhbGciOiJIUzI1NiIsInR5cCI6IkpXVCJ9.eyJzdWIiOiI3pWF3_In0.aXYsHiog